The rate of time passage is most likely subjective to you, as you get older, because increments of time continue to represent a smaller overall percentage of your life thus far. I mean, for a 5yr old, for example, one year will seem like a huge increment of time because it's a fifth of their entire lifetime; but for a 25yr old it's only 1/25th of the total life lived-so a year feels shorter. I think that's why time feels "sped up' as we grow older.

However there are pretty simple explanations within our local rules of time and space for our current dystopian situation.
2012/13 is when smart phones became pervasive and hit saturation. People started increasingly living in their screen. This led to opinion based social media to takeoff - and then to become manipulated.
About the same time is when we began to get the woke cancel culture really rolling, which then had a huge backlash.
The 2015 US presidential campaign codified the derision and disdain of expertise. As a culture, we openly began to lose respect for experts and higher education and experience. The opposite of those things were framed as fresh and good. 2016 codified the alternate facts reality out loud.
You can look at this as the fruition of things that have been going on since at least the late 90s:
CNN in the start of the 24 seven new cycle where news became fragmented and led to echo chambers.
The foundations of geopolitics and Russia's active strategy to create instability through disinformation.
Then you had 9/11 and the patriot act which allowed for espionage upon private citizens in the name of fighting terror because of course we all want to be safe and not have another horrific event like that.
Then you have the rollout of voting machines with no paper trails which makes it infinitely easier to cheat than paper ballots.
And don't forget the cabal of global elites engaging in human trafficking and pedophilia reveling in being above the law which the Epstein case has brought to light.
There are no doubt other factors, but these are just some of them that makes it feel like the future dystopia has arrived. But we didn't get here in a vacuum. There was a whole series of bad choices made by the powers that be in a whole constellation of social factors that got us here.

I can probably offer a scientific explanation for *one* secondary matter that you touched on. Human minds subjectively experience the passage of time in a compressed manner as they get older. You'll probably find that the majority of your most vivid memories come from roughly age 10-30, due to a combination of novelty and quantity of memories to draw from overall. When things started getting really messy back around 2020, there was a lot of novelty to it. Every day was a new fresh hell. After daily assaults on our sensibilities, shocking and disturbing twists stopped having the same effect - regardless of age. Which would account for the feeling of time speeding up both as you age, and especially since things started going sideways around here.
Basically, I'm not disputing nor confirming your theory that something is very wrong on a metaphysical level. But the experience of it in the way you described at least has an explanation based in some preliminary scientific studies.
